How Attic Water Extraction Works in Kenmore, WA

When you call our team for Attic Water Extraction services, we’ll send a crew to your property to assess the damage and develop a plan. This involves inspecting your attic for signs of water damage, such as discoloration, warping, or musty odors. We’ll also use specialized equipment to detect any hidden water pockets or structural damage.

Step 1: Inspection and Assessment

Our technicians will examine your attic carefully, looking for any signs of water damage or structural issues. This is a critical step, as it helps us find out the extent of the damage and develop a plan to fix it.

Our team uses advanced equipment to detect hidden water pockets and structural damage. We’ll check for warping, discoloration, and musty odors, as well as look for any signs of mold or mildew. This helps us identify the root cause of the problem and develop a plan to fix it.

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ying

Once we’ve identified the source of the water damage, we’ll use specialized equipment to extract the water and dry the affected area. This involves using industrial-strength vacuums and dehumidifiers to remove moisture from the air and surfaces.

Our team will also use specialized equipment to dry the affected area quickly and safely. We’ll use desiccants and drying agents to speed up the process, and ensure that your property is dry and safe within 3-5 days.

Warning Signs You Need Attic Water Extraction in Kenmore, WA

Beware of the following warning signs that you need Attic Water Extraction services: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Musty odors in your attic can be a sign of hidden water damage or mold growth. If the smell persists even after cleaning, it’s time to call our team for Attic Water Extraction services.

Discoloration or Warping on Ceiling Tiles or Walls

Discoloration or warping on ceiling tiles or walls can be a sign of water damage or structural issues. If you notice any of these symptoms, call our team for Attic Water Extraction services.

Water Stains on the Ceiling or Walls

Water stains on the ceiling or walls can be a sign of a leaky roof or faulty plumbing. If you notice any of these symptoms, call our team for Attic Water Extraction services.

Mold Growth or Mildew

Mold growth or mildew can be a sign of hidden water damage or poor ventilation. If you notice any of these symptoms, call our team for Attic Water Extraction services.

High Humidity or Moisture Levels

High humidity or moisture levels in your attic can be a sign of hidden water damage or poor ventilation. If you notice any of these symptoms, call our team for Attic Water Extraction services.

Visible Water Damage or Leaks

Visible water damage or leaks in your attic can be a sign of a serious problem. If you notice any of these symptoms, call our team for Attic Water Extraction services immediately.

Attic Water Extraction Cost in Kenmore, WA

The cost of Attic Water Extraction services in Kenmore, WA can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. But, here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Inspection and Assessment $200 – $500 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ment used
Mold Remediation and Prevention $500 – $1,000 Size of affected area, severity of mold growth, equipment used
Restoration and Repair $1,000 – $3,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, materials used
Final Inspection and Certification $100 – $300 Severity of damage, size of affected area

Common Questions About Attic Water Extraction

Q: How long does Attic Water Extraction take?

A: The time it takes to complete Attic Water Extraction services can vary dep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. But, our team can typically complete the service within 3-5 days.

Q: Is Attic Water Extraction covered by insurance?

A: Yes, Attic Water Extraction services may be covered by your insurance policy. Our team will work with you and your insurance company to ensure that you receive the maximum coverage possible.

Q: Do I need to vacate my property during Attic Water Extraction services?

A: In most cases, you can stay in your property during Attic Water Extraction services. But, our team may recommend that you vacate the property temporarily if the damage is severe or if there are safety concerns.

Q: Can I do Attic Water Extraction myself?

A: No, it’s not recommended that you try to do Attic Water Extraction yourself. This type of service needs specialized equipment and expertise to ensure that the job is done safely and effectively.

Q: How do I prevent future Attic Water Extraction services?

A: To prevent future Attic Water Extraction services, it’s essential to maintain a healthy attic environment. This includes ensuring proper ventilation, controlling moisture levels, and inspecting your attic regularly for signs of damage or mold growth.
